Brokefetch revived(ish)

I forked and revived Brokefetch – now on Homebrew 🍺🐧

Hey everyone, I recently forked and revived an old project called Brokefetch — a humorous, minimalist alternative to neofetch that gives you your system info with a healthy dose of existential dread.

I’ve packaged it for Homebrew (macOS/Linux), so now you can install it easily with:

brew tap T1mohtml/brokefetch
brew install brokefetch

Once installed, just run brokefetch in your terminal. It’ll display your system info — OS, kernel, shell, RAM, etc. — but with some dark humor sprinkled in. It’s basically the fetch noscript for when life’s a bit too real. 🥲

Whether you're broke, broken, or just bored, this is a fun little tool to throw in your dotfiles or screenshots.

What are your most commonly used helpful command line tools that might be lesser known?

Here are some I use:
tldr - usually has the info I'm looking for quickly available instead of reading through the whole man page
bat - cat with syntax highlighting
fuck - I suck at typing

Idk if these are super unheard of but I never really see anyone talk about them. Y'all got any more you'd like to add? I'm interested to see what other people have found useful

It's always a permissions issue!

My wife asked me to print something from my Arch Linux laptop, and they wouldn't print. We were under a time crunch for an appointment later that day, so she printed it from her phone or Mac, I'm not sure which. I've been so busy with the kids and family life that I don't have time to fiddle with this stuff anymore, at least not lately.

I finally got some time yesterday, and realized my user lost membership in the cups and lp groups. I added those groups, re-enabled the printer, and both jobs printed!

homectl really needs the option like usermod -a for appending to the group list....

How-to: Disable indentation of wrapped text in Kate

tl;dr: Settings -> Configure Kate -> Appearance -> General -> (Scroll way down) Indent Wrapped Lines

I made the switch to Kate from a closed source editor a while back. For the most part, I've had no complaints. However, like most things KDE, I find that I feel that the settings fight me. The setting above disables a purely cosmetic indentation that is distracting and unhelpful to me.

HOWEVER, Kate has an entire 'Indentation' tab in its settings with zero reference to the above setting. This is simply a side-effect of KDE's 'all the customization you could want' ethos. It makes web searches for the issue almost impossible since any result is inevitably about code indentation and wrapping.

I worked this out simply by merit of exhausting every search result a few months ago, and then forgot to write the damn thing down.

One of the beauties of the open source ethos is that you can document your own problems and solutions to them. So when I went to set up Kate on another computer, refinding the solution to this problem in the process, I decided to document it here since KDE's documentation doesn't seem to mention it at all. patchmon : Linux Patch Monitoring software opensource

I've had an issue where I wanted something self-hosted, clean and simple to monitor my linux servers update status.


Current working features:

Dashboard on hosts summary / status
Easily register hosts with the app
View and search for packages that have been installed


Planned features:

Authentication improvements : Each host to authenticate via unique api credentials to patchmon
Ability to add Clients, Locations and host groups so that hosts can be associated to them
PDF Report generation of single host or group of hosts


This will be opensource and I will be releasing by the 1st of September.

I'm open to people who want to give me feature requests and contribute to the app - It's written in Next JS for both the backend and frontend.


Open to ideas, constructive criticism and security ideas / features.

No ports on the host need to be opened as the hosts will push the collected information to patchmon (either self-hosted or we will offer a cloud hosted one for a small fee).
